Now, let’s talk about the structure of the BNCC. It’s organized into different areas of knowledge, such as Languages, Mathematics, Natural Sciences, Human Sciences, and Arts. Within each area, there are specific competencies and skills that students are expected to develop at each stage of their education. These competencies aren't just about memorizing facts; they're about applying knowledge in real-world situations. For example, in Mathematics, students aren't just expected to learn formulas; they're expected to use mathematical reasoning to solve problems. In Languages, they're not just expected to learn grammar rules; they're expected to communicate effectively in different contexts.

One of the most significant ways the BNCC is used is in curriculum development. Schools and teachers use the BNCC as a guide to design their curricula, ensuring that they are covering the essential learning objectives. This doesn't mean that every school's curriculum will look exactly the same, though. The BNCC provides a framework, but it allows for schools to adapt the curriculum to their specific contexts and the needs of their students. For example, a school in a rural area might incorporate local knowledge and traditions into their curriculum, while still aligning with the BNCC's overall goals. This flexibility is crucial for making education relevant and engaging for all students.
The BNCC also impacts teaching practices. Teachers are encouraged to use active learning strategies that promote student engagement and critical thinking. This means moving away from traditional lecture-based teaching and incorporating more hands-on activities, group work, and project-based learning. The BNCC also emphasizes the importance of formative assessment, which is the ongoing process of monitoring student learning and providing feedback to help them improve. This allows teachers to identify areas where students are struggling and to adjust their instruction accordingly. Assessment is another area where the BNCC has a significant impact. Traditional tests that focus on memorization are becoming less common, and there is a greater emphasis on assessing students' ability to apply their knowledge in real-world situations. This might involve projects, presentations, or performance-based tasks. The goal is to measure not just what students know, but also what they can do. The BNCC also promotes the use of a variety of assessment methods, including self-assessment and peer assessment, to give students a more comprehensive picture of their learning.
Beyond the classroom, the BNCC is influencing the development of educational materials, such as textbooks and online resources. Publishers are aligning their materials with the BNCC's learning objectives, ensuring that students have access to high-quality resources that support their learning. The BNCC is also being used to inform teacher training programs, so that new teachers are well-prepared to implement the curriculum.
